What is Capable?
Capable is an organization dedicated to lifting families in Northern Uganda out of extreme poverty through a holistic program. This initiative encompasses intensive training, personalized mentorship, and crucial market linkage strategies. The company's core philosophy centers on fostering a shift in mindset, cultivating individual agency, and building robust community cooperatives to ensure enduring economic advancement. By prioritizing deep local relationships and tailoring its services to meet specific community needs, Capable has demonstrated a proven ability to significantly increase client incomes while simultaneously reducing operational costs. Their commitment to durable and meaningful outcomes is evident in their success to date.
